QualificationsKNOWLEDGE / SKILLS / ABILITIES: High school diploma or equivalent Must be dependable, punctual and have effective communication skills Must demonstrate a positive approach toward customers and other staff members, acting in a highly professional manner at all times Must be able to maintain confidentiality of donor or patient information at all times ADDITIONAL DUTIES, RESPONSIBLITIES AND QUALIFICATIONS: LEVEL II: All of the above, plus Consistent with training, performs intermediate product management duties, including: Irradiates product as necessary Monitors equipment and responds to alarms and alerts; performs preventative maintenance of equipment Makes decisions relative to quality control (including shipment temperature checks, discarding/destroying of unsuitable units, shipping of expired units for further manufacturing), safety issues, company policies and public relations May provide immediate guidance and direction to junior technicians Performs departmental record control responsibilities to include review, corrective action and organization Requires 6 months of on-the-job experience and meets or exceeds all position competencies and departmental quality standards. Must have successfully completed training on use of irradiator (where applicable) LEVEL III: All of the above, plus Consistent with training, performs advanced product management duties, including: Release of directed units, shipping of dangerous goods, manual labeling, processing test-positive Autologous units, and receiving blood derivatives Monitors product storage equipment, audit reports, alarm activation for Datatron and other system function checks, sets up RTD calibrator Requires 12 months of on-the-job experience and meets or exceeds all position competencies and departmental quality standards. PHYSICAL DEMANDS / WORKING CONDITIONS / ENVIRONMENT: Work requires frequent operation of a vehicle, sometimes for long periods of time. Must be able to lift equipment, such as coolers and shipping packages, up to 40 lbs., unassisted. Must be able to work irregular hours, often in excess of 8 hours per day, and weekends and holidays. Must be able to work with needles, scissors, blood bags, human blood and blood processing equipment and work in a fast-paced environment. Work involves potential exposure to infectious diseases from blood and blood products. Requires operation of a Company vehicle for blood transport; must possess a valid driver’s license and be insurable by our commercial auto insurance carrier.
